数据,已成为这个时代的基调。当我们因为数据带来新的机遇而喜不自胜的时候,也常常会不可避免地遇到一些随之而来的困扰。与如何更好地使用数据相比,数据的存储和管理是更棘手的问题所在。
面对海量数据爆炸式的增长和发掘数据内在价值的巨大需求,拥有弹性伸缩、无限扩展能力的云存储正发展成为时代的智能数据底座。
日前,笔者有幸来到了位于北京天辰东路国家会议中心的京东云,听京东云IaaS研发总监陈峰,为我们详细解读了京东云携手英特尔打造高性能云硬盘背后的故事。
挑战/瓶颈
2015年,京东开始布局公有云,其研发团队分为IaaS、PaaS、SaaS三个方向,陈峰主要负责IaaS,据介绍,京东云高性能云硬盘主要面临以下挑战:
1,由于京东的业务扩展,存储增长迅速;
2,正常的SATA和非易失性存储SSD对于京东某些应用来说还不够快;
3,需要满足最高性能需求;
4,需要提高存储效率,降低TCO;
近年来,京东云在整个京东集团中扮演着越来越重要的角色。为能够在实现高吞吐量的同时提供安全、稳定、兼具弹性、高性价比的服务,京东正在基于英特尔存储组合打造高I/O云服务框架。
陈峰表示:“京东云与英特尔始终保持着紧密的合作,京东云已经率先采用了英特尔的傲腾技术,并应用于云硬盘和块存储中,除了在英特尔傲腾和NVMe固态盘硬件上的合作外,还在底层技术,包括分布式存储、架构上有着诸多的合作。”
对症下药
据陈峰介绍,京东云高性能云硬盘这个应用场景与英特尔傲腾数据中心级持久内存的定位非常匹配,傲腾持久内存的特点是介于内存和SSD之间的一款产品,京东高性能云硬盘信息密度比较高,所以需要有性能更好的一层存储设备来做缓存。目前京东云主要用傲腾做一层缓存,未来Optane大规模用于整体替代NVMe也是很有可能的。
京东云利用Optane为虚拟机提供低延迟,高持久性和高可靠性数据块级存储。云盘中的数据存储在多个实时副本中,以防止因组件故障导致数据不可用,同时还能提供高可用性数据存储服务。云盘容量允许弹性扩展,可以在几分钟内以较低的价格扩展数据存储空间,以实现数据的持久存储。
作为一种全新的存储设备,傲腾持久内存拥有低延时、高稳定性、高耐用性的优势。据了解,Optane已经在京东云的生产上得到了广泛的应用,京东云也在探索Optane更多方向的使用,未来也考虑作为启动盘启动以及加快系统的启动速度上去使用傲腾持久内存。
在软件开发方面,陈峰表示:“英特尔有一个库,可以让使用者更好的用那个模式开发,也给我们提供了更多的可能性,傲腾持久内存把我们软件的开发变得简单一点。我们也希望能有更多的人来使用傲腾持久内存,只有这样傲腾持久内存才能在数据中心中全面铺开。”
在服务响应方面,据陈峰介绍,京东跟英特尔合作都是ODM的模式,会把包括CPU、内存、硬盘、网卡、主板等重要的硬件进行自设计或通过核心供应商去采购,傲腾持久内存也是京东直接从英特尔进行采购的,之后会设计开发服务器产品。不仅如此,英特尔还推出了英特尔开放零售倡议(ORI),其中京东已经作为早期合作伙伴正式加入该倡议。
写在最后,为什么京东会率先选择英特尔傲腾?那是因为傲腾既拥有革命性的高吞吐量、低延迟、高服务质量和高耐用性;又拥有配套硬件、软件的完善生态系统;还拥有高效响应机制为企业客户提供服务保障。
笔者认为今天英特尔傲腾数据中心级持久内存在市场上所处的位置,和几年前固态盘刚刚进入时非常相似,虽然还未得到大范围的普及,但众多领先企业已经纷纷开始采用,看到像京东云这样领先的互联网服务商通过傲腾来显着提升存储能力,我们有理由相信,在经过市场的验证后,傲腾将像当初的固态盘一样,获得更多用户的认可。